NFL Draft
Ah yes, what a beautiful thing the NFL is. It would be even more amazing if they go to the 18 game schedule. Absolutely loved the Bengals picks. They were ballsy considering some minor character issues, but we got some of the best talent in the whole draft. Andre Smith looks like the real deal. He's just a bit immature and did some dumb stuff, but as long as he's not another gang-banger, I'll take him to watch Carson's back any day. Then was my favorite pick: REY MAUALUGA!!! I kept praying he would fall to us. And then the Browns passed on him and I knew he was ours. Thanks Cleveland. Is he the most talented LB in the draft? No. He just has that mean streak and swagger that every defense needs. He can be our Polomaulu, our Ray Lewis, our (enter a good defensive Cleveland player...cause I can't think of any). So excited to see what this guy can do. Michael Johnson was another gem and should bring a better element of pass rusher than our overpaid Geathers and Odom have been providing. I'm not giving up on those guys yet, but they definitely need to step it up. Picking up a pass catching TE in Chase Coffman was solid, so now we can team him and Utecht in 2 TE sets. My only complaint is that we addressed the center position too late. I don't know anything about this Jonathan Luigs but I'm very concerned that were going to get dominated in the interior line. If it means getting Maualuga and passing on a center till later...I guess I can live with that.
As the Browns were going along, I liked their strategy. Trade down, trade down, trade down...stockpile picks. It's a good strategy. Then comes their first pick...Alex Mack. Hmm little high for a center but as me and Hewls were discussing that day...O-line is always a good investment. Then came the 2nd pick...Robiskie??? Okay WTF?! I'm sure Buckeye Nation loves the pick, but I think it's horrible. If they wanted to address center and wideout, they could have snagged Hakeem Nicks in the 1st and Max Unger in the 2nd. That would have made so much more sense to me. And they passed on Maualuga. AND they snag ANOTHER wideout with their next pick (although I like the Massaquoi pick so much better than Robiskie). Rest of their draft made sense as far as addressing defense the rest of the way. 3 6th round corners was a bit puzzling, but not as maddening as I found their first 2 picks.
I'd comment on the Steelers' draft, but it was somewhat forgettable. Not bad, not great. Just solid. No real names that popped off the page, but that will happen when you're the defending champs. I'm sure they're all turn out to be monsters on the gridiron as the Steelers continue to be the bane of my existence.
